Overview

The Minolta MC Rokkor 85mm f/1.7 is Minolta's portrait gem — a relatively unknown lens outside dedicated circles that punches way above its weight. While Canon and Nikon got the glory for their 85mm offerings, the Minolta quietly delivered beautiful portrait rendering at a fraction of the price.

Verdict: The portrait secret. The MC Rokkor 85mm f/1.7 delivers gorgeous portraits at a price that makes Canon/Nikon owners jealous. If you shoot Minolta or adapt to mirrorless, this deserves attention.

Optical Character

Color

Warm Minolta tones

Sharpness wide open

Good center wide open, excellent stopped down

Flare resistance

Well-controlled

Contrast

Medium contrast

Vignetting

Present wide open
